1. Simplicity Creates Stronger Brand Recognition
One of the biggest secrets used by successful brands is simplicity. The most recognizable logos and marketing materials are often the simplest because they are easier to remember. Clean layouts, minimal distractions, and clear messaging help customers instantly understand a brand's identity. Rather than overcrowding a design with unnecessary graphics, top designers focus on creating visuals that communicate one strong message. This minimalist approach improves readability and strengthens brand recall across digital and print platforms. Many successful branding experts emphasize that simplicity increases user engagement and enhances long-term brand recognition.
2. Color Psychology Influences Customer Decisions
Colors play a significant role in shaping customer emotions and purchasing behavior. Leading brands carefully choose their color palettes because every color communicates a different feeling. Blue often represents trust and professionalism, red creates excitement and urgency, green symbolizes growth and sustainability, while black conveys luxury and sophistication. Consistent use of colors across websites, social media, advertisements, and packaging helps establish a recognizable visual identity. Understanding color psychology enables designers to create stronger emotional connections with their audience while reinforcing the brand's personality.
3. Typography Communicates Brand Personality
Fonts are more than decorative elements—they reflect a brand's personality. Luxury brands often use elegant serif fonts, technology companies prefer clean sans-serif typography, while creative businesses experiment with custom lettering. Top brands maintain consistent typography across every marketing channel to strengthen their identity. Proper font pairing, spacing, alignment, and hierarchy make content easier to read while enhancing professionalism. Effective typography guides viewers through the content naturally and ensures the most important information receives immediate attention.
4. Consistency Builds Trust
Successful brands never change their visual identity randomly. They maintain consistency across logos, color schemes, typography, photography style, icons, and layouts. This consistency helps customers instantly recognize the brand regardless of where they encounter it. Whether someone visits a website, scrolls through social media, or receives a brochure, the overall visual experience remains familiar. Brand consistency creates credibility, improves customer confidence, and supports long-term business growth. Professional design teams often rely on detailed brand guidelines to ensure every piece of content reflects the same identity.
5. White Space Makes Designs More Powerful
Many beginner designers feel the need to fill every empty area with graphics or text, but experienced designers understand the importance of white space. Empty space improves readability, highlights important elements, and gives designs a clean, premium appearance. Luxury brands frequently use generous spacing because it directs the viewer's attention toward the primary message. Proper spacing also enhances user experience by making websites, advertisements, and presentations easier to navigate and understand. White space is not wasted space—it is an essential design tool.

7. Strong Visual Hierarchy Guides the Viewer
Professional designers organize information so viewers naturally notice the most important content first. This principle, known as visual hierarchy, uses size, color, contrast, spacing, and placement to direct attention. Headlines are larger, call-to-action buttons are more prominent, and supporting information is organized logically. This structured approach improves readability while encouraging users to take desired actions, such as making a purchase or signing up for a service. Effective visual hierarchy significantly enhances user experience across websites, mobile applications, and marketing materials.

9. Design Trends Are Used Carefully
Leading brands stay updated with modern design trends but never follow every trend blindly. Instead, they adopt only those trends that align with their brand identity and improve user experience. Minimalism, bold typography, gradient effects, 3D illustrations, AI-assisted design tools, and motion graphics have become increasingly popular, but successful brands combine these trends with timeless design principles. This balance ensures their visual identity remains modern without becoming outdated quickly. Designers who understand both classic fundamentals and emerging trends are highly valued in today's creative industry.
